Durability That Delivers When Buying Used Cameras in 2025

Pro-grade cameras are built to last, with magnesium alloy bodies, weather sealing, and shutters rated for 200,000+ clicks. Buying used cameras in 2025 means banking on gear that’s proven its grit. My used Canon 5D Mark III has survived rain-soaked shoots and dusty trails without a hiccup. Check shutter counts on GearFocus listings to gauge wear, and you’ll find pre-owned cameras that outshine new budget models. Buying used cameras in 2025 is about investing in longevity, not gambling on flimsy entry-level gear.

Firmware Updates Boost Value When Buying Used Cameras in 2025

Think used means outdated? Not in 2025. Camera makers are dropping firmware updates that supercharge older models with sharper autofocus, better video, and more. A used Sony A7R III from 2021 might now rock improved eye-tracking or 10-bit video—features once exclusive to new gear. I updated my used Fujifilm X-T2, and it’s like a new camera with faster focusing and richer colors, all for free. Buying used cameras in 2025 means getting gear that evolves with you, staying competitive without the premium price.

Shop Smart When Buying Used Cameras in 2025

To nail your purchase, approach buying used cameras in 2025 like a pro. Check shutter counts to assess wear—most cameras show this in their menus. On GearFocus, scrutinize listings for detailed photos and seller ratings; good sellers share gear histories. Ask about returns or warranties, as many platforms offer a safety net. Test the sensor for dead pixels (shoot a blank wall at high ISO) and inspect lenses for fungus or scratches. I once skipped a lens deal because the photos showed haze—trust your instincts to avoid duds. These steps ensure you score a reliable rig that fits your style.
